WebThe myocardium is mainly made up of two types of cells: cardiomyocytes and fibroblasts. Fibroblasts are distributed between cardiomyocytes, along with extracellular matrix (ECM), blood vessels, lymphatic vessels, and nerve endings. The ECM contains fibrillar collagen network, proteoglycans, glycosaminoglycans, and the basement membrane.
